Texas Transportation Institute

Company Details:
Texas A&M University
System 3135 TAMU
College Station, TX 77843-3135

Phone: (979) 845-1713

TTI's mission is to solve transportation problems through research, to transfer technology, and to develop diverse human resources to meet the transportation challenges of tomorrow.

Average Commuter Delayed 34 Hours, Costing $750, in 2010

September 27, 2011
From Texas Transportation Institute